Various factors can lead to corrosion such as oxygen diffusing into the water of recirculation, or a low pH and an increased electrical conductivity of the system water. The accumulation of sludge and corrosion products in heating and cooling systems can cause severe hydraulic problems – Carbon Steel Pipework systems in particular can be prone to this.
Using sacrificial magnesium anodes to extract oxygen, acid and aggressive salts from the water, Elysator addresses both the symptoms and root causes of corrosion within recirculation heating and cooling systems. Elysator’s proven technology creates environments for these systems so corrosion can’t occur and bacteria can’t survive.
Elysator’s corrosion protection systems are unique to the market, by which they separate gasses, absorb acids, and filter sludge particles – all at the same time. This ensures valuable components and re-circulation water system problems can be protected.
The electro-chemical reaction of the sacrificial magnesium anode is reliable, measurable and works without chemical additives, resulting in lower maintenance costs and less system downtime.
